Langer hints at minimal changes for Indian Tests – cricket.com.au
An unbeaten home summer means Australia’s selectors have all but settled on their Test squad to take on India already

Australia will go almost a year between Test matches but coach Justin Langer expects to take a similar squad into the upcoming four-match series against India.
The world No.1 ranked Test team hasn’t played together since completing a 3-0 sweep of New Zealand at the SCG in January.
Australia planned to face Bangladesh in July, but that two-Test series was postponed because of COVID-19.
